Specification breakdown
| Spec | GOTRAX GXL Commuter v2 | EVOLV Tour XL Plus |
|---|---|---|
| Range (mi) | 10.1 mi | 21.1 mi |
| Top speed (mph) | 13.5 mph | 29.8 mph |
| Weight (lbs) | 27.1 lbs | 55.6 lbs |
| Motor power (W) | 250 W | 600 W |
| Battery capacity (Wh) | 187 Wh | 874 Wh |
| Brakes | Disc | Disc |
| Tires | Pneumatic | Pneumatic |
| Waterproof rating | IP54 | IP54 |
| Suspension | None | Dual Spring |
| Price (USD) | $349 | $1,295 |
